Fundamentals of experimental design, key points, and points to keep in mind when using it

Understanding Experimental Design

Experimental design is a fundamental aspect of scientific research that helps in understanding relationships among variables and testing hypotheses.
It’s a framework that outlines how to conduct experiments and analyze the results effectively.
By following a structured approach, researchers can ensure that their findings are valid, reliable, and applicable to broader contexts.

At its core, experimental design involves setting up controlled environments to manipulate one or more variables while observing the effects on other variables.
This allows researchers to draw conclusions about cause-and-effect relationships.
The clarity and structure provided by a well-thought-out experimental design enable scientists to reduce biases, increase precision, and facilitate replication of the study by others.

The Importance of Experimental Design

The primary goal of any experimental design is to minimize errors and increase the credibility of the findings.
Without a proper design, experiments can lead to incorrect conclusions due to extraneous variables or uncontrolled factors.
Hence, experimental design is a crucial step that helps in the accurate interpretation of results, fostering scientific advancements.

A robust design not only helps in testing the hypothesis but also clarifies the methodology, ensuring that other researchers can verify the results.
This transparency is vital for scientific progress, as it facilitates peer review and enables subsequent research to build upon established findings.

Key Points in Experimental Design

There are several key points that should be considered when developing an experimental design:

1. Clear Research Questions and Hypotheses

Defining a clear research question and corresponding hypotheses is the first step in any experimental design.
This step ensures that the study has a focused purpose and guides the entire process.
A well-designed experiment always revolves around specific questions or hypotheses that it seeks to address.

2. Selection of Variables

Identifying dependent, independent, and control variables is essential.
The independent variable is the one that is manipulated, while the dependent variable is the outcome that is measured.
Control variables are other factors that must be kept constant to ensure that the experiment results solely from changes in the independent variable.

3. Randomization

Randomization involves the random assignment of subjects to different groups or conditions.
This process helps in eliminating bias and ensures that the groups are comparable at the start of the experiment.
Randomization is particularly crucial in experiments involving human subjects to balance characteristics across groups and avoid systematic errors.

4. Replicability

One of the hallmarks of sound experimental design is the ability to replicate the study.
Designing experiments that can be repeated with the same methodology ensures that the results are not due to chance.
Replicability is essential for validating the outcomes and supporting scientific theories.

5. Sample Size and Selection

Choosing an appropriate sample size is critical to ensure valid results.
A sample that is too small might not provide significant data, while a too large sample might result in unnecessary complexity and resources.
Selecting a representative sample group from the population under study is another essential consideration to ensure that findings can be generalized.

Points to Keep in Mind for Effective Use

Though experimental design is a systematic approach, it’s vital to be mindful of several points to utilize it effectively.

1. Balance Between Control and Naturalism

While it’s important to control variables, overly controlled environments can become too artificial.
Balancing control with naturalism ensures that the findings are applicable in real-world scenarios.
Designs should try to mimic natural conditions as closely as possible, while still allowing for control over the variables being tested.

2. Ethical Considerations

Ethics play a significant role in experimental design, especially when human or animal subjects are involved.
Ensure that the design includes informed consent, confidentiality, and the right to withdraw from the study at any point without consequences.
Adhering to ethical guidelines maintains the integrity of the research and the well-being of participants.

3. Using Pilots and Pre-Tests

Conducting a preliminary pilot study or pre-test can help identify potential problems in the experimental design.
These preliminary studies can refine the methodology, tweak variables, and adjust measurements.
This step can save time and resources in the actual experiment by addressing unforeseen issues beforehand.

4. Interpretation of Results

While designing the experiment is crucial, interpreting the results requires equal attention.
The analysis should consider all variables and potential confounding factors.
Statistical tools and methods should be employed to accurately represent the data and draw meaningful conclusions.
